Crafted from lightweight polyethylene mesh, the mask allows for good airflow while effectively keeping flies and gnats at bay. A soft fleece band minimizes rubbing for all-day comfort, and the eye dart seams are positioned on the outside of the mask to prevent any irritation to your animal's face. The mask fits comfortably over the ears and secures with an adjustable reinforced 1" Velcro chin strap for a snug, reliable fit.

Sizing Guide:
- X-Small — Young weanling alpacas and llama crias, approximately 3–4 months old (Tan)
- Small — Weanling to yearling llamas, and yearling to adult alpacas with smaller to average size heads and minimal head wool (Grey)
- Medium — Adult alpacas with very large heads or significant head wool, and 2-year-old up to adult llamas with smaller heads (Red)
- Large — Adult llamas with very large heads (Tan)
Please note: Head wool can affect fit. If your animal has a lot of head wool — or a recently shorn topknot — please keep this in mind when selecting your size.
